WebSeptum (pl. septa) A cross wall in a hypha. Solitary: Alone. Spinulose: Covered in small spines. Sporangiolum (pl. ) A small sporangium producing a small number of sporangiospores. Sporangiophore: A specialized hypha that bears a sporangium. Sporangiospore: An asexual spore produced within a sporangium.
